One such player is Carl Medjani, who has seen limited playing time at Olympiakos. He has signed with Valenciennes in a bid to reignite his career. Rafik Djebbour, a former striker for Sivasspor in Turkey, has made a move to Nottingham Forest Football Club in England, seeking new opportunities.
Other Algerian players like Mesbah and Belfodil have secured loan moves to Livorno, providing them with a chance to showcase their talents. Cadamuro, a former defender for Sochaux, has also benefited from a loan move to Mallorca in Spain.
However, not all transfers have been successful. Nabil Ghilas, who plays second fiddle to Jackson Martinez at Porto, has been unable to secure a move away from the Portuguese club due to his coach’s disapproval. Similarly, Medhi Lacen, a defensive midfielder for Getafe CF, did not receive offers that met his expectations and will remain in Spain for the time being.
